Finding the Land Trails
The things you really want to look for are food scrap piles, tree gnawing marks, trail starts
at any water’s edge, and droppings.
Food scrap piles can be found for both beaver and muskrat. The beaver likes the inside,
soft, tasty portion of the trees’ bark, or they will eat all the new, soft bark offshoots and
soft branch twig ends. If food is plentiful, you’ll find that they will leave piles of bark with
just the soft inner layer scraped out.
